The financier must use for conditional residency by sending an I-485 request. This petition needs to be submitted within 6 months of the I-526 authorization and should include proof that the financial investment was made and that it has actually created a minimum of 10 full time work for U.S. employees. The USCIS will examine the I-485 request and either authorize it or request added evidence.


Within 90 days of the conditional residency expiry day, the investor needs to send an I-829 application to remove the conditions on their residency. This request has to include proof that the investment was continual and that it developed at least 10 full-time tasks for United state workers.

The minimum amount of capital needed for the EB-5 visa program might be reduced from $1,050,000 to $800,000 if the financial investment is made in an industrial entity that is situated in a targeted employment location (TEA). To get the TEA designation, the EB-5 task have to either remain in a rural location or in a location that has high unemployment.
